1 Plus 2 Equals 3: A Poker Player’s Value is Determined by Their Bottom Line
February 16th, 2010 by Mason

A number of poker tactics will amaze you with their simplicity. This is sample. Note your conclusions, every time you play.

Cathedral of Texas Holdem Verse #4:

Thou have to record your successes and thy squanders; for it is the sum total of all a mans achievements which create his/her bottom line.

How detailed is your decision. I tend to consider that hourly info and that type of intimate information is wasted. Simply work out how far ahead you are and how much (if any) you’ve taken out. Naturally, if you are beaten, record that too, despite how much it it might pain you.

Don’t overlook to note what style of poker you are wagering on, if that is important to you. (In my expertise, most gamblers stick to what they understand and don’t try something they do not know. If all you note is winnings, loses and withdrawals, you are light years ahead of most gamblers out there!)

Give yourself realistic ambitions, like a ‘dream’ target (new car, get-a-way or whatever). When you take out, mark the $$$$$ taken out to your dream tally. The more successful you are, the closer that dream will get!
